Krisumi Corporation was formed in 2018 as a 50:50 joint venture between Japan's Sumitomo Corporation and India's Krishna Group. The name Krisumi combines "Kri" from Krishna and "Sumi" from Sumitomo, and also draws on "Kriya" (creation in Sanskrit) and "Sumi" (fine living in Japanese). This linguistic integration reflects the project's broader design philosophy: Japanese precision with Indian warmth.
Sumitomo Corporation is part of the 400-year-old Sumitomo Group, a Fortune 500 conglomerate headquartered in Tokyo. With operations in 66 countries, the corporation has completed over 300 large-scale real estate projects globally. Its entry into the Indian market through Krisumi Corporation was motivated by the gap between rising consumer expectations and delivery standards in Indian real estate. Masahiro Narikiyo, then Chairman and MD of Sumitomo Corporation India, said at the 2018 JV announcement that India's real estate sector had consumers with evolved expectations but traditional developers who were finding it difficult to meet them — a problem Sumitomo's systems and processes were designed to address.
Krishna Group is a Gurgaon-based conglomerate led by Ashok Kapur, with over 47 years of diversified industry experience across auto components, entertainment seating, media, and travel. Kapur co-founded Sona Koyo Steering Systems Limited — India's largest steering system company — in 1985 alongside his brother Dr. Surinder Kapur. The group won the prestigious Deming Prize under his leadership. Kapur started acquiring the 65 acres of land in Sector 36A directly from farmers in 2012, predating the JV formation and positioning the township for long-term development.
The entire Krisumi City development spans 65 acres in Sector 36A with a planned investment exceeding $2 billion and a total built-up area of over 18 million sq ft. The township follows a mixed-use master plan designed by Nikken Sekkei Japan's largest and oldest architecture firm — and includes residential towers, retail spaces, hospitality, office zones, and an integrated social infrastructure. All phases are constructed by Tier-1 contractors including Tata Projects.

Krisumi Waterside Residences is located immediately adjacent to the Global City project — a 1,002-acre state-driven smart township in Sectors 36B, 37A, and 37B along Dwarka Expressway. Haryana's Chief Minister confirmed in early 2026 that Phase 1 of Global City (587 acres) will be completed by December 2026, with roads, drainage, power, and water infrastructure underway. The full project targets completion by 2035 with an investment of ₹1 lakh crore and approximately 5.2 lakh new jobs. The Phase 1 infrastructure contract of ₹940 crore has already been awarded and work is in progress.
Buyers choosing Krisumi Waterside Residences are effectively buying into the immediate catchment of one of India's most significant government-backed urban development projects.
The Forest Reserve is the branding concept applied to Phases 5 and 6 of Krisumi City, which are the most recently launched phases of the Krisumi Waterside Residences series. These phases (RERA numbers RC/REP/HARERA/GGM/944/676/2025/47 and RC/REP/HARERA/GGM/945/677/2025/48) were launched in 2025-26 and introduce a forest-themed living concept within the township.
The Forest Reserve concept centers on a 33-acre forest-inspired landscape, the "Chinju No Mori" — a Japanese concept referring to sacred groves attached to shrines, typically left as natural refuges. Within Krisumi City, this translates to preserved green corridors, forest-themed communal spaces, bamboo groves, and a landscape designed by Japanese consultants who prioritize canopy cover and natural ecosystems over conventional manicured gardens.
The Forest Reserve phases are positioned as ultra-luxury, with exclusively 4 LDK + S (Living, Dining, Kitchen plus Study) configurations across 150 residences per phase. A 1-lakh sq ft clubhouse is planned for these phases.

Krisumi Waterside Residences uses the LDK (Living, Dining, Kitchen) planning format standard in Japanese residential design. In conventional Indian apartment layouts, the living room, dining area, and kitchen are often separate or partially separated spaces. The LDK concept integrates them into one connected social zone, which maximises the feel of space in the apartment's common areas.
Practical implications include:
The living-dining-kitchen area in a 3 LDK apartment of approximately 2,260 sq ft is typically more open and usable than the equivalent area in a traditionally planned Indian apartment of the same size. This is because fewer partition walls are used in the social zone, with privacy design focused on the bedroom and private spaces instead.
Balconies in the Waterside Residences are typically sized to serve as functional extensions of the living space, with adequate depth for seating. Large format balconies on golf-side or green-facing units are among the more requested inventory at the project.
Penthouses in the 5,453 and 5,867 sq ft range are among the largest apartment formats currently available in any under-construction project on Dwarka Expressway. These configurations address demand from HNI buyers who want floor-plate exclusivity without committing to a standalone villa.
Buyers should request the RERA-mandated carpet area disclosure before booking. The carpet area is the legally binding measurement under RERA and will be less than the super area stated above.

The Dwarka Expressway, now fully operational, has structurally improved the location calculus for Sector 36A. Travel time to Delhi has shortened significantly, and the expressway provides a direct, signal-free route to IGI Airport — a critical factor for professionals and NRI buyers.
The Global City project represents one of the most significant government-backed real estate developments adjacent to any existing residential cluster in NCR. Spanning 1,002 acres across Sectors 36-37D, it is being developed under the DMIC (Delhi-Mumbai Industrial Corridor) framework with an investment potential of approximately $15 billion. Phase 1 infrastructure covering 587 acres was under construction as of early 2026, with target completion by December 2026. The full project targets completion by 2035, projected to generate approximately 5.2 lakh jobs.
The development will include Grade-A offices, a financial centre (FC1 and FC2 zones for banking and fintech), residential zones, retail, hotels, an integrated MRTS system with 6 stations, and a 15-minute city design framework where all amenities are accessible within a 15-minute walk.
The employment that Global City will generate creates a direct, long-term rental demand anchor for residential projects in immediately adjacent sectors. Krisumi Waterside Residences' position literally next to Global City gives it a structural advantage over projects in sectors that are 5-10 km farther from the development.

RERA verification. Confirm the project registration status, possession date, and escrow bank details on hrera.gov.in using RERA number RC/REP/HARERA/GGM/812/544/2024/39.
Phase clarification. The Krisumi City township has multiple phases with different RERA numbers. Confirm exactly which phase and which towers your unit belongs to before booking.
Carpet area. Request the RERA-mandated carpet area in writing. The super areas (1,740 to 5,867 sq ft) include common spaces and structural elements. Pricing under RERA must be based on carpet area.
Club membership terms. The 36,000 sq ft clubhouse serves the broader Krisumi City township. Confirm what membership is included, what it costs on a monthly or annual basis, and whether the clubhouse is managed by the developer or a residents' association.
Modular kitchen and VRV inclusions. The project advertises fitted kitchens and VRV air conditioning. Confirm the brand, specification, and what is covered in the base price versus what is charged separately.
Payment schedule. Confirm whether the project is on a construction-linked payment plan (CLP) or a time-based plan. CLP structures tie payments to construction stages, providing buyer protection if construction is delayed.
PLC and GST. The indicative prices above are typically stated before GST and Preferential Location Charges for higher floors or preferred-facing units. Request a complete cost sheet. The difference between headline price and all-in acquisition cost typically runs 12-18%.
Parking allocation. Confirm the number of car parks included per unit and any charges for additional parking.
Legal approvals. Apart from RERA, verify that the project holds all required approvals from DTCP Haryana, GMDA, fire authorities, and environment clearances as applicable.

This section addresses the broader context of investing in under-construction Dwarka Expressway developments, which applies to Krisumi Waterside Residences as well as any other project in this corridor.
Infrastructure timelines. The Dwarka Expressway's full completion improved connectivity dramatically, but supporting infrastructure — Global City, the ISBT, the planned metro extension — remains in varying stages of progress. Buyers should price in their own assessment of how much of this infrastructure will be operational by their possession date, since the rental and capital appreciation case partly depends on these projects delivering on schedule.
Rental demand. Demand is structural rather than speculative, anchored by Cyber City employment, the airport, and the emerging Manesar-Global City commercial belt. Premium gated community rentals in this corridor have sustained demand from senior professionals and expatriates.
Future supply. Multiple premium projects are under construction in Sector 36A and adjacent sectors. Increased supply at possession (2029-2031) could moderate near-term resale pricing, though integrated townships with strong brands typically hold better than standalone towers.
Resale potential. Under-construction luxury resale on Dwarka Expressway has been active in recent years, with secondary market pricing on several projects tracking above launch rates. Krisumi's delivered phase resale activity provides a visible reference. However, resale liquidity in the ultra-luxury segment (₹10 Cr+) is inherently more limited than in the ₹2-5 Cr mid-luxury range.
Maintenance considerations. Integrated townships have higher maintenance infrastructure than standalone buildings, which generally means higher monthly maintenance charges. Understand the complete maintenance structure before comparing net yield calculations with simpler residential projects.
